How Can You Enhance Your Scribing Techniques for Better Gundam Models?

To enhance your scribing techniques for better Gundam models, focus on selecting the right tools, practicing precision, using appropriate techniques, and applying consistent finishes.

Choosing the right tools: Select a high-quality scribing tool, such as a scribe chisel or a scribing tool with interchangeable blades. These tools provide better control and accuracy while cutting into the plastic surface.

Practicing precision: Practice control over the depth and steadiness of your cuts. Scribing should create clean lines without excess pressure that could damage the model. Consistent practice helps develop muscle memory, improving your overall technique.

Using appropriate techniques: Employ various techniques such as grid lines or reference marks to guide your scribing. Start with shallow cuts and gradually deepen them to achieve the desired depth and width without risking breakage of the plastic. Using a straight edge can help maintain straight lines.

Applying consistent finishes: After scribing, use sanding sticks to smooth any rough edges. This creates clean lines that enhance the overall aesthetics of your model. Finishing touches, including painting and weathering, can also highlight the scribed details, making them more prominent in the final look.

By focusing on these areas, you can significantly improve your scribing skills and the quality of your Gundam models.

What Maintenance Practices Ensure Longevity of Your Scribe Chisel for Gundam?

To ensure the longevity of your scribe chisel for Gundam model building, regular and proper maintenance practices are essential.

  1. Clean the chisel after each use.
  2. Store the chisel in a protective case.
  3. Regularly sharpen the blade.
  4. Check for signs of damage.
  5. Use appropriate cutting techniques.
  6. Avoid excessive pressure during use.

These practices are generally agreed upon, but some users argue that not all chisels require the same level of care depending on the specific material and frequency of use. There are also differing opinions on how often to sharpen the blades, with some preferring a more frequent schedule than others based on their cutting style.

  1. Cleaning the Chisel After Each Use:
    Cleaning the chisel after each use is vital for maintaining its effectiveness. Residue from cutting can dull the blade and lead to corrosion if left uncleaned. Use a soft cloth or brush to remove any debris and ensure the blade remains free from contaminants.

  2. Storing the Chisel in a Protective Case:
    Storing the chisel in a protective case prevents accidental damage. A case shields the blade from potential impacts and environmental factors that can degrade its quality. Models with a fitted compartment or foam insert provide the best protection.

  3. Regularly Sharpening the Blade:
    Regularly sharpening the blade keeps the chisel performing at its best. A sharp edge allows for more precise cuts and reduces the amount of force required during usage. Use a fine sharpening stone or a specialized sharpening tool for best results.

  4. Checking for Signs of Damage:
    Checking for signs of damage involves inspecting the blade and handle for chips, cracks, or warping. Damage can affect performance and the tool’s safety. If damage is found, it is best to repair or replace the chisel promptly.

  5. Using Appropriate Cutting Techniques:
    Using appropriate cutting techniques reduces wear on the chisel. Employ steady, controlled movements rather than excessive force. Understanding the material being cut also dictates the angle and pressure to apply, which can vary between plastics and harder materials.

  6. Avoiding Excessive Pressure During Use:
    Avoiding excessive pressure during use is crucial to prevent damaging the chisel or the model itself. Forcing the chisel can lead to diminished control and increase the risk of accidents. Proper technique allows for effective cutting without undue strain on the tool.
